“The essence of supervision in a Thinking Environment is to create a partnership for thinking well and to support getting to the core of what is most important for the supervisee. It is for the supervisee to develop expertise in thinking for themselves about their work - and all it’s facets - with their clients. It is about the supervisor generating new insights in the supervisee through giving Attention and Encouragement- and giving input when asked for, rather than imposing it...it is about helping the supervisee develop expertise in helping their clients to think for themselves.”
— The Heart of Coaching Supervision, 2019

🌀 Supervision That Sparks Independent Thinking

To coach at our best, we need time to reflect on our practice — to notice patterns, ask better questions, and listen to ourselves more fully.
Supervision should offer that space.

In this course, you’ll learn and practise the elegant 4-step Thinking Environment® supervision process. You’ll explore how to:

  • Hold supervision sessions that feel clear, structured, and deeply respectful

  • Work with both individual and group supervisees

  • Offer input briefly and only when truly invited

  • Trust your presence more than your performance

✅ You’ll Leave With:

  • A grounded understanding of the Time to Think supervision process

  • Confidence using it in both formal and informal supervision contexts

  • Clarity on when and how to offer input without disrupting independent thinking

  • A supervision map that’s flexible, rigorous, and deeply human

How is this different from what we already offer in Faculty training?
Faculty training equips you to teach the Time to Think certification courses. This supervision course focuses specifically on how to support students during the practicum, offering a clear 4-part structure for individual, peer, and group supervision.

Will this change how I currently supervise?
Possibly — but only for the better. You’ll discover ways to offer less advice, ask fewer questions, and generate more profound thinking from your supervisees. It’s a return to the essence of what makes the Thinking Environment so powerful.
